Technical SEO is the invisible architecture of your website — the code, structure, and performance layers that determine whether search engines can truly see and understand your content. It’s not about keywords or backlinks, but about speed, crawlability, mobile experience, and the trust signals baked into your site’s foundation. Without strong technical SEO, even the best content struggles to rank. And while this guide covers the major pillars, it is by no means exhaustive — it merely scratches the surface of what’s possible.
What we will explore here are the key areas every site should address, but technical SEO is vast. From log file analysis and crawl budget management, to advanced JavaScript rendering and structured data at scale — the deeper layers go far beyond what fits into one article. Think of this as a foundation, not a finish line. Think of it as scratching the surface.
What is Technical SEO and Why Does It Matter?
Technical SEO ensures your site can be crawled, indexed, and understood by search engines. It handles the infrastructure that supports your on-page and off-page work.
Why it matters:
- Search engines need clean access to your site.
- A slow or broken site leads to lower rankings and poor user engagement.
- Technical SEO amplifies the ROI of your content and link-building.
Mobile Optimization: Still #1 in 2025
Google still uses mobile-first indexing. That means if your mobile version fails, your SEO fails.
Mobile optimization essentials:
- Responsive layouts that adapt fluidly to screen size.
- WebP or AVIF images to cut file weight without losing quality.
- Buttons and menus sized for thumbs, not cursors.
- A clean design that avoids intrusive popups.
In short: If your site isn’t smooth on mobile, it isn’t optimized at all.
Site Speed and Core Web Vitals
Speed has become a non-negotiable ranking factor. Core Web Vitals are still the benchmarks Google uses to measure it:
- LCP (Largest Contentful Paint): < 2.5 seconds.
- INP (Interaction to Next Paint): Instant responsiveness when a user clicks or taps.
- CLS (Cumulative Layout Shift): Minimal layout jumps while loading.
Fixes that work:
- Preload key assets (fonts, hero images).
- Lazy-load images below the fold.
- Minify CSS and JavaScript.
- Enable server-level caching and CDNs.
Fast pages aren’t just for Google — they convert more leads into sales.
Schema Markup for Rich Results
Schema is the structured data that tells Google what your page is about. It unlocks rich snippets and even visibility in AI overviews.
Types to use in 2025:
- FAQ Schema: For grouped Q&A.
- HowTo Schema: For guides and tutorials.
- Organization/Service Schema: To reinforce authority.
When you combine schema with quality content, you win both visibility and trust.
Handling Duplicate Content and Canonicals
Duplicate content creates confusion and dilutes ranking signals.
How to handle it:
- Use canonical tags to show which version is the “master.”
- 301 redirect old or duplicate URLs to their primary version.
- Consolidate thin posts into comprehensive resources.
Remember: every page should serve a clear, unique purpose.
Sitemaps and Robots.txt Best Practices
Think of these as your site’s instructions to Google:
- XML Sitemap: Acts as your roadmap, telling Google which pages to crawl.
- Robots.txt: Tells crawlers what to avoid (like admin or test pages).
- Use noindex tags for low-value pages (thank-you pages, staging sites).
- Keep both updated — automation is your friend here.
Measuring Technical SEO Success
Tracking progress is as important as the work itself.
Key tools and KPIs:
- Google Search Console: Index coverage, crawl stats, mobile usability.
- PageSpeed Insights: Track Core Web Vitals improvements.
- Server logs & monitoring: Spot crawl bottlenecks and 404 errors.
- Conversions: A fast, stable site means more completed forms, calls, and sales.
FAQs
What is technical SEO?
It’s the backend optimization that ensures search engines can crawl, index, and understand your site.
How important is site speed for SEO?
Very. A slow site damages rankings, frustrates users, and kills conversions.
What is schema markup?
Structured data that communicates your content’s meaning to Google, enabling rich results and enhanced SERP visibility.
Do I need both XML sitemap and robots.txt?
Yes. Sitemaps guide crawlers; robots.txt sets crawl rules. They work together.
How do I fix duplicate content issues?
Use canonicals, redirects, or consolidation to focus authority on one primary page.






















